WebSapelo Island / ˈ s æ p əl oʊ / is a state-protected barrier island located in McIntosh County, Georgia.The island is accessible only by boat; the primary ferry comes from the Sapelo Island Visitors Center in McIntosh County, Georgia, a seven-mile (11 km), twenty-minute trip. It is the site of Hog Hammock, the last known Gullah community.
